PROBLEM TO BE SOLVED: To improve sound absorption performance, with a simple structure.SOLUTION: A sound absorption structure (1) comprises: a rear side surface member (21) having length in a predetermined direction; a front side surface member (22) having length along the predetermined direction which is shorter than that of the rear side surface member (21); and a sound absorber (3). The front side surface member (22) is arranged in parallel to the rear side surface member (21) and forward separated from the rear side surface member (21). The sound absorber (3) is disposed on a first area (24) exposed from an opening (23) which is a front side of the rear side surface member (21) and is adjacent to the front side surface member (22) in the predetermined direction, and extends to a second area (25) sandwiched by the front side surface member (22) and the rear side surface member (21).SELECTED DRAWING: Figure 1
